Understanding Periodontics: The Foundation of Dental Health
Periodontics is a specialized branch of dentistry focused on the structures that support our teeth, primarily the gums and jawbone. It involves understanding the complex relationship between oral health and overall well-being. By delving into periodontics dentistry, we uncover the foundation upon which a healthy smile is built.
Gums aren’t just the pink flesh around our teeth; they are integral to maintaining dental stability. Periodontists, specialists in this field, diagnose and treat gum diseases ranging from mild inflammation to severe conditions affecting the bone. Regular check-ups with periodontics experts can help identify potential issues early, ensuring prompt treatment and preserving both oral and systemic health.
The Role of Periodontal Care in Maintaining a Beautiful Smile
Periodontics dentistry plays a crucial role in maintaining a beautiful and healthy smile. Beyond simply addressing gum disease, periodontics focuses on the supportive structures of your teeth—gums, bone, and ligament—to ensure they remain strong and intact. Regular periodontal care includes deep cleaning procedures, such as scaling and root planing, which remove plaque and tartar buildup that regular brushing and flossing might miss. This not only prevents gum inflammation but also stops the progression of periodontitis, a condition that can lead to tooth loss if left untreated.
By keeping your gums healthy through periodontics dentistry, you create a solid foundation for your teeth. Healthy gums are less susceptible to bacterial infections and support optimal chewing function and overall oral health. Moreover, recent studies have linked periodontal disease to various systemic conditions, including heart disease, diabetes, and respiratory issues, highlighting the importance of maintaining not just a beautiful smile but also overall well-being.
Advanced Periodontal Treatments: Restoring and Protecting Your Oral Well-being
In cases where advanced periodontal disease has set in, modern periodontics dentistry offers a range of treatments designed to restore oral health and prevent further damage. These advanced procedures go beyond basic scaling and root planing, addressing complex issues like bone loss and tissue regeneration. One such innovative approach is tissue-regenerative therapy, which encourages the body’s natural healing mechanisms to rebuild damaged gum tissues and bone structures.
Another notable treatment option includes surgical procedures like flap surgery and bone grafting. These techniques are meticulously planned to create a healthy environment for teeth and gums, promoting long-term stability and reducing the risk of future periodontal issues. With these advanced periodontics dentistry treatments, patients can not only achieve a healthier smile but also safeguard their overall oral well-being.
